# Rotational Cipher
Create an implementation of the rotational cipher, also sometimes called the Caesar cipher.
The Caesar cipher is a simple shift cipher that relies on
transposing all the letters in the alphabet using an integer key
between `0` and `26`. Using a key of `0` or `26` will always yield
the same output due to modular arithmetic. The letter is shifted
for as many values as the value of the key.
The general notation for rotational ciphers is `ROT + <key>`.
The most commonly used rotational cipher is `ROT13`.
A `ROT13` on the Latin alphabet would be as follows:
```text
Plain: abcdefghijklmnopqrstuvwxyz
Cipher: nopqrstuvwxyzabcdefghijklm
```
It is stronger than the Atbash cipher because it has 27 possible keys, and 25 usable keys.
Ciphertext is written out in the same formatting as the input including spaces and punctuation.
## Examples
- ROT5 `omg` gives `trl`
- ROT0 `c` gives `c`
- ROT26 `Cool` gives `Cool`
- ROT13 `The quick brown fox jumps over the lazy dog.` gives `Gur dhvpx oebja sbk whzcf bire gur ynml qbt.`
- ROT13 `Gur dhvpx oebja sbk whzcf bire gur ynml qbt.` gives `The quick brown fox jumps over the lazy dog.`
## Running tests
Execute the tests with:
```bash
$ elixir rotational_cipher_test.exs
```
### Pending tests
In the test suites, all but the first test have been skipped.
Once you get a test passing, you can unskip the next one by
commenting out the relevant `@tag :pending` with a `#` symbol.
For example:
```elixir
# @tag :pending
test "shouting" do
assert Bob.hey("WATCH OUT!") == "Whoa, chill out!"
end
```
Or, you can enable all the tests by commenting out the
`ExUnit.configure` line in the test suite.
```elixir
# ExUnit.configure exclude: :pending, trace: true
```
